Job description

The PMO will develop and implement best practices to enable the successful delivery of the Smart Working+ programme to stakeholders across the business. The PMO is a key resource in effective programme delivery, it defines the standards for project management, and provides decision support for information. The PMO underpins the project delivery mechanisms by ensuring that all business change on the programme is managed in a controlled way.

Responsibilities:

  • Monitor Programme reporting and assist the Digital Programme Manager in reporting to Senior Management. Establish frameworks and standards for Programme and Project Management Manage and compile Programme related financial and KPI information.
  • Oversee project costs and ensure finances are well managed.
  • Prepare and present cost-benefit analysis to support business case development and the implementation of projects. Provide and maintain a capacity planning and resource tracking service across the Programme.
  • Update and maintain the Risk Log, Action Log, Decisions Log, and Issue Register Ensure the appropriate programme benefits are identified, quantified and their realisation planned.
  • Track financial reporting whilst ensuring that the programme and projects adhere to the corporate financial processes.
  • Ensure cross-programme dependencies are managed and the dependency log is accurately maintained.
  • Provide a quality assurance role in line with defined Programme Management Office process.
  • Coordinate project closure to distil good practice and ensure lessons learned are logged.
  • Provide Project planning, Milestone management, Scope management, Resource forecasting; Financial Management; Change Management across the programme.
  • Prepare regular status reporting to the Programme Manager.
  • Ensure efficient change control methods and process are utilised.
